Description

CASI Pharmaceuticals, Inc. is a biopharmaceutical company focused on the development and commercialization of innovative therapeutics. The company's primary clinical development program centers on CID-103, an investigational anti-CD38 monoclonal antibody. This therapy is being developed to treat antibody-mediated rejection (AMR) in organ transplant recipients and for various autoimmune diseases, addressing a significant unmet medical need. In addition to its research and development pipeline, CASI maintains a portfolio of commercialized pharmaceutical products, primarily targeting the oncology market.
